Transaction 31e8625991482475bcf77882b9a5f1ede5900349b42749ee8d9532daec26619f
1 Input
1 Output
-
31e8625991482475bcf77882b9a5f1ede5900349b42749ee8d9532daec26619f:0
- value
- 79708
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2be8ed2084615d9cefda8d39aa80d82cc7c1cf5
- address
- bc1qk2lga5sggc2annha4rfe42qdstx8c884kksejz